  • Fundamental study on the filtered containment venting system for decommissioning of the Fukushima Nuclear Power Plant

抄録

During the decommissioning of the Fukushima Nuclear Power Plant after severe accident, the process of cutting the core debris (using a laser cutter, wire cutter or drilling machine) will generate a large amount of radioactive aerosol. Therefore, the air cleaning system should be needed to prevent the release of radioactive materials into the environment. For this purpose, an integral filter system including three filter layers has been developed: the wet-type aerosol filter, multi-stage metal fiber filter and the zeolite filter for organic iodine removal. The wet-type filter plays an important role in effective removal the aerosol particles from the venting system and it should be properly investigated. In this study, the behavior of bubble distribution in the two-phase flow of the wet-type filter layer was investigated for the difference of the air injection flow rate.
